Barry Beach was tried and convicted 30 years ago for murder. There was a confession that he has maintained was coerced 3 years after the murder. There was no evidence what so ever to link Barry to the crime. Dateline has had 3 separate episodes regarding this case. There was a Montana judge that had set him free for 18 months. He was then returned to prison. This man has many supporters the Montana Governor has sent a letter recommending clemency. In Montana the governor can't pardon a prisoner.
